/* CSS Document */

body {
	background: url(../images/fondsite.jpg);
	background-attachment:fixed;
	height: 100%;
	width: 100%;
	margin: 0;
	padding: 0;
	border: none;
	font-family: Verdana;
	text-align: left;
	font-size: 8px;
	color: #3F8EC7;
	margin: 0; /* pour éviter les marges */
	text-align: center; /* pour corriger le bug de centrage IE */
	scrollbar-face-color: #3F8EC7;
	scrollbar-shadow-color: #000000;
	scrollbar-highlight-color: #FFFFFF;
	scrollbar-3dlight-color: #000000;
	scrollbar-darkshadow-color: #000000;
	scrollbar-track-color: #babcbc;
	scrollbar-arrow-color: #FFFFFF;
	height: 100%;
}
/* tableau central */
.cadre_centre {
	width:1000px;
	height:100%;
	margin-left: auto;
	margin-right: auto;
	text-align: left; /* on rétablit l'alignement normal du texte */
	color: #C6D4DF;
}
#cadre_centre {
	width:1000px;
	height:100%;
	margin-left: auto;
	margin-right: auto;
	text-align: left; /* on rétablit l'alignement normal du texte */
}
/* bloc des news */	
#news {
	background-image:url(../images/fond_bloc_droit_actus.png);
	font-family: Verdana;
	color: #071e2d;
	font-size:8pt;
	height:178px;
	text-align:justify;
}
/* bloc découvrez l'effet colibri */	
#qui_sommes_nous {
	background-image:url(../images/fond_decouvrez_lassociation.png);
	font-family: Verdana;
	color: #071e2d;
	font-size:10pt;
	height:220px;
width=529px;
	text-align:justify;
}
/*  recherche */	
#recherche {
	background-image:url(../images/fond_page.png);
	font-family: Verdana;
	color: #071e2d;
	font-size:8pt;
	height:521px;
	text-align:justify;
}
/*  page confirm newsletter */
#newsletter {
	width:700px;
	height:495px;
	font-size:12px;
	color:#003;
	margin: 0;
}
#texte_newsletter {
	width:476px;
	height:35px;
	top:123px;
	right: 270px;
	position:absolute;
}
/*  éléments formulaire de contact */
.error {
	font-family:Verdana, sans-serif;
	font-size:10px;
	color:#F00
}
.textes_formulaire_contact {
	font-family:Verdana, sans-serif;
	font-size:11px;
	color:#0E4870
}
.bouton {
	background-color:#3F8EC7;
	color:#FFFFFF;
	cursor:pointer;
	float:left;
	font-size:11px;
	margin:10px 0;
	padding:5px 10px
}
.champ_formulaire {
	font-family:Verdana, sans-serif;
	font-size:11px;
	color:#ffffff;
	background-color:#3F8EC7
}
/*  liens Qui sommes nous */
.liens_actions {
	font-family: verdana;
	font-size: 12px;
	color: #2D2C13;
	text-decoration: none;
}
a.liens_actions: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#2D2C13;
}
/*  liens Vie du projet*/
.liens_appel {
	font-family: verdana;
	font-size: 12px;
	color: #1B4767;
	text-decoration: none;
}
a.liens_appel: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#1B4767;
}
/*  liens Nos partenaires */
.liens_partenaires {
	font-family: verdana;
	font-size: 12px;
	color: #312710;
	text-decoration: none;
}
a.liens_partenaires: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#312710;
}
/*  liens Contact */
.liens_contact {
	font-family: verdana;
	font-size: 12px;
	color: #061C2B;
	text-decoration: none;
}

.liens_contact_gras {
	font-family: verdana;
	font-size: 12px;
	color: #061C2B;
	font-weight:bold;
	text-decoration: none;
}

.liens_contact_italique {
	font-family: verdana;
	font-size: 12px;
	color: #061C2B;
	font-style:italic;
	text-decoration: none;
}

a.liens_contact: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#061C2B;
}
/*  liens l'Effet Colibri vous recommande */
.liens_recommande {
	font-family: verdana;
	font-size: 12px;
	color: #5E534D;
	text-decoration: none;
}
a.liens_recommande: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#5E534D;
}
/*  liens  Espace Vidéos */
.liens_video {
	font-family: verdana;
	font-size: 12px;
	color: #893B8C;
	text-decoration: none;
}
a.liens_video: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#893B8C;
}
/*  liens Offres Emplois */
.liens_emplois {
	font-family: verdana;
	font-size: 12px;
	color: #8E8E8E;
	text-decoration: none;
}
a.liens_emplois: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#8E8E8E;
}
/*  liens Documents */
.liens_documents {
	font-family: verdana;
	font-size: 12px;
	color: #31592D;
	text-decoration: none;
}
a.liens_documents:hover {
	font-family: verdana;
	font-size: 12px;
	color: #FFFFFF;
	background-color:#31592D;
}
/*  Info bulle */
    a.infobulle em {
	display:none;
}
a.infobulle {
	text-decoration:underline;
	font-family: Verdana;
	color: #071e2d;
}
a.infobulle:hover {
	border: 0;
	position: relative;
	z-index: 500;
	text-decoration:none;
	background-color:#E9F1F6;
}
a.infobulle:hover em {
	z-index: 500;
	font-family:Verdana;
	text-align:left;
	font-size:11px;
	font-style: normal;
	display: block;
	position: absolute;
	top: 20px;
	left: +20px;
	padding: 5px;
	color: #FFFFFF;
	border: 1px solid #001F33;
	background: #3F8FC8;
	width:200px;
}
a.infobulle:hover em span {
	z-index: 500;
	position: absolute;
	top: 1px;
	left: 1px;
	height: 24px;
	width: 150px;
	background-image:url(../images/infobulle.jpg);
	background-repeat: no-repeat;
	margin:0;
	padding: 4;
	border: 0;
}
/*  eco gestes */
#eco_gestes {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color:#24628D;
	overflow:auto;
	position:relative;
	left:1px;
	top:6px;
	width:700px;
	height:518px;
	z-index:3;
}
#titre_eco_gestes {
	font-family:Verdana, Geneva, sans-serif;
	font-weight:bold;
	text-align:left;
	font-size:12px;
	color:#24628D;
	position:absolute;
	left:233px;
	top:9px;
	width:432px;
	height:51px;
	z-index:3;
}
.legende_eco_gestes {
	font-family:Verdana, Geneva, sans-serif;
	font-size:10px;
	color:#24628D;
	font-weight:100
}
/*  socio gestes */
#socio_gestes {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color:#24628D;
	overflow:auto;
	position:relative;
	left:1px;
	top:6px;
	width:700px;
	height:518px;
	z-index:3;
}
#titre_socio_gestes {
	font-family:Verdana, Geneva, sans-serif;
	font-weight:bold;
	text-align:left;
	font-size:12px;
	color:#24628D;
	position:absolute;
	left:233px;
	top:9px;
	width:432px;
	height:51px;
	z-index:3;
}
.legende_socio_gestes {
	font-family:Verdana, Geneva, sans-serif;
	font-size:10px;
	color:#24628D;
	font-weight:100
}
/*  insertion blog */
#direct_blog {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	text-align:justify;
	line-height:16px;
	color: #071e2d;
	position:absolute;
	/*left:219px;*/
	top:526px;
	width:528px;
	height:253px;
	z-index:1;
}
#liens_blog {
	font-family: verdana;
	font-size: 12px;
	color: #1B4767;
	text-decoration: none;
}
/*  tableau sites internet*/
#tableau_sites_internet {
	position:relative;
	left:1px;
	top:0px;
	width:700px;
	height:520px;
	z-index:3;
}
#tableau_interne_sites {
	z-index:4;
	overflow:auto;
	top:20px;
	height:430px;
}
.intro_sites_internet {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color: #071e2d;
}
table#sample {
	background-color:#DBD1CC;
	width: 96%;
}
table#sample td {
	padding: 0px;
	border: solid #84766F 0px;
	text-align: left;
}
.data_sites_internet {
	color: #071e2d;
	text-align: left;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	background-color: #CCCCCC;
}
.toprow {
	text-align: center;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color:#FFF;
	background-color: #72665F;
}
.leftcol {
	font-weight: bold;
	color: #071e2d;
	text-align: left;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	width: 150px;
	background-color: #CCCCCC;
}
/*  tableau offres d'emploi*/
#tableau_offres_emploi {
	position:absolute;
	overflow:auto;
}
.intro_offres_emploi {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color: #071e2d;
}
table#sample {
	background-color:#DBD1CC;
	width: 100%;
	text-align: center;
}
table#sample td {
	padding: 0px;
	border: solid #84766F 0px;
	text-align: left;
}
.data_offre_emploi {
	color: #071e2d;
	text-align: left;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	background-color: #CCCCCC;
}
.toprow_emploi {
	text-align:center;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color:#FFF;
	background-color: #A6A6A6;
}
.leftcol {
	font-weight: bold;
	color: #071e2d;
	text-align: right;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	width: 70px;
	background-color: #CCCCCC;
}
/*  tableau press room*/
#tableau_press_room {
	position:absolute;
	overflow:auto;
}
.intro_press_room {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color: #071e2d;
}
.soustitre_press_room {
	font-family:Verdana, Geneva, sans-serif;
	font-size:10px;
	color: #071e2d;
}
table#sample {
	background-color:#DBD1CC;
	width: 100%;
	text-align: center;
}
table#sample td {
	padding: 0px;
	border: solid #84766F 0px;
	text-align: left;
}
.data {
	color: #071e2d;
	text-align: left;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	background-color: #B4CBB2;
}
.toprow_pressroom {
	text-align:center;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color:#FFF;
	background-color: #457141;
}
.leftcol_press_room {
	font-weight: bold;
	color: #071e2d;
	text-align: right;
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	width: 100px;
	background-color: #B4CBB2;
}
/*Texte important*/
.important {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color:#600;
	text-decoration: blink;
}
#popExemple {
	width:220px;
	height:190px;
	position: absolute;
	top: 237px;
	left: 355px;
	z-index: 10000; /* utile pour que votre fenêtre passe au dessus du reste */
}
#info_home {
	font-family:Verdana, Geneva, sans-serif;
	font-size:12px;
	color:#600;
	width:300px;
	height:50px;
}

/* plan du site*/
# plan_site {background-color:#0C6; position:absolute; width:400px; height:300px}

#visuel_plan_site {
	position:relative;
	left:10px;
	top:20px;
	width:271px;
	height:307px;
	z-index:1;
}
#liens_plan_site {
	background-color:#D1D9DF;
	position:absolute;
	left:640px;
	top:254px;
	width:398px;
	height:493px;
	z-index:2;
}
#liens_plan_sitesuite {
background-color:#D1D9DF;
	position:absolute;
	left:848px;
	top:254px;
	width:218px;
	height:493px;
	z-index:2;
}
.liens_plan {
	font-family: verdana;
	font-size: 10px;
	color: #8E8E8E;
	text-decoration: none;
}
.liens_plan_titre {
	font-family: verdana;
	font-size: 10px;
	color: #2F1F14;
	text-decoration: none;
}
a.liens_plan:hover {
	font-family: verdana;
	font-size: 10px;
	color: #ffffff;
	
}

#plansite tr:hover {
   background-color:#A9C1D9;
}

